Pakistan successfully test-fired a nuclear-capable ballistic missile, military officials said, just a week after India's new government took office. The firing of the Hatf V surface-to-surface missile, witnessed by Prime Minister Zafarullah Jamil at an undisclosed location, was Pakistan's first such test since March. A military statement said the test was carried out as part of ongoing efforts to improve Pakistan's missile systems.
